     30 #define R(x) (static_cast<unsigned int>(x))
     31 
     32 // The MIPS uapi ptrace.h has the wrong definition for pt_regs. PTRACE_GETREGS
     33 // writes 64-bit quantities even though the public struct uses 32-bit ones.
     34 struct pt_regs_mips_t {
     35   uint64_t regs[32];
     36   uint64_t lo;
     37   uint64_t hi;
     38   uint64_t cp0_epc;
     39   uint64_t cp0_badvaddr;
     40   uint64_t cp0_status;
     41   uint64_t cp0_cause;
     42 };
     43 
     44 // If configured to do so, dump memory around *all* registers
     45 // for the crashing thread.
     46 void dump_memory_and_code(log_t* log, pid_t tid) {
     47   pt_regs_mips_t r;
     48   if (ptrace(PTRACE_GETREGS, tid, 0, &r)) {
     49     return;
     50   }
     51 
     52   static const char REG_NAMES[] = "$0atv0v1a0a1a2a3t0t1t2t3t4t5t6t7s0s1s2s3s4s5s6s7t8t9k0k1gpsps8ra";
     53 
     54   for (int reg = 0; reg < 32; reg++) {
     55     // skip uninteresting registers
     56     if (reg == 0 // $0
     57         || reg == 26 // $k0
     58         || reg == 27 // $k1
     59         || reg == 31 // $ra (done below)
     60        )
     61       continue;
     62 
     63     uintptr_t addr = R(r.regs[reg]);
     64 
     65     // Don't bother if it looks like a small int or ~= null, or if
     66     // it's in the kernel area.
     67     if (addr < 4096 || addr >= 0x80000000) {
     68       continue;
     69     }
     70 
     71     _LOG(log, logtype::MEMORY, "\nmemory near %.2s:\n", &REG_NAMES[reg * 2]);
     72     dump_memory(log, tid, addr);
     73   }
     74 
     75   unsigned int pc = R(r.cp0_epc);
     76   unsigned int ra = R(r.regs[31]);
     77 
     78   _LOG(log, logtype::MEMORY, "\ncode around pc:\n");
     79   dump_memory(log, tid, (uintptr_t)pc);
     80 
     81   if (pc != ra) {
     82     _LOG(log, logtype::MEMORY, "\ncode around ra:\n");
     83     dump_memory(log, tid, (uintptr_t)ra);
     84   }
     85 }
